Exploring Educational Resources for Students in Mississauga High Schools




Mississauga, Ontario, is a vibrant city known for its cultural diversity, economic growth, and excellent educational opportunities. With a plethora of high schools scattered across the city, students have access to a wide range of resources to support their academic journey and personal growth. Whether it's academic assistance, extracurricular activities, or mental health support, Mississauga high schools strive to provide comprehensive resources to nurture the potential of every student.

1.Academic Support:

High schools in Mississauga understand the importance of academic success and offer various resources to support students in their learning endeavors. From dedicated teachers who provide extra help during office hours to peer tutoring programs, students have access to assistance in various subjects. Additionally, many schools provide access to online resources and digital libraries, enabling students to explore educational materials beyond the classroom.

2.Extracurricular Activities:

Beyond academics, Mississauga high schools encourage students to explore their interests and talents through extracurricular activities. Whether it's sports teams, music ensembles, debate clubs, or community service initiatives, there is something for everyone. These activities not only provide opportunities for personal development and skill-building but also foster a sense of belonging and camaraderie among students.

3.Career Guidance and Pathways:


High schools in Mississauga are committed to helping students explore their career interests and plan for their future. Guidance counselors offer individualized support, assisting students in identifying their strengths, interests, and career goals. Additionally, many schools organize career fairs, guest speaker sessions, and workshops to expose students to various career pathways and educational opportunities beyond high school.

4.Mental Health and Wellness Support:

Recognizing the importance of mental health and well-being, Mississauga high schools prioritize the emotional and psychological needs of students. Guidance counselors, social workers, and psychologists are available to provide counseling and support services. Schools also organize wellness events, mindfulness sessions, and stress management workshops to promote mental health awareness and resilience among students.

5.Technology and Innovation:

In today's digital age, technology plays a crucial role in education. Mississauga high schools integrate technology into the learning environment, providing students with access to computers, tablets, and educational software. Many schools also offer coding clubs, robotics teams, and STEM programs to foster innovation and creativity among students.

6.Community Partnerships:

High schools in Mississauga recognize the importance of community partnerships in enriching the educational experience of students. They collaborate with local businesses, universities, and nonprofit organizations to provide students with internship opportunities, mentorship programs, and community service projects. These partnerships help students gain real-world experience, build valuable connections, and make a positive impact in their community.


In conclusion, students in Mississauga high schools have access to a wealth of resources to support their academic, personal, and professional growth. From academic support and extracurricular activities to career guidance and mental health services, these resources empower students to thrive and succeed in their educational journey. With a supportive and nurturing environment, Mississauga high schools are dedicated to helping students reach their full potential and become confident, well-rounded individuals ready to contribute to society.
